US 11,990,714 B2
Electrical receptacle assembly with outward-biasing faceplate

1. An electrical faceplate assembly, comprising:
a yoke physically couplable to an underlying structure, the yoke including a receiver portion to physically couple to an electrical device insert;
a faceplate assembly that includes a faceplate member having a front surface, a rear surface, and an external perimeter, the faceplate member including:
an aperture extending from the front surface of the faceplate member to the rear surface of the faceplate member;
a peripheral wall extending from the rear surface of the faceplate member, the peripheral wall disposed about at least a portion of the perimeter of the aperture; and
a plurality of biasing members, each of the plurality of biasing members extending from the peripheral wall at least partially into the aperture;
each of the plurality of biasing members to exert a biasing force that displaces the faceplate assembly away from the underlying structure; and
each of the plurality of biasing members to further contact the electrical device insert when the electrical device insert is physically coupled to the yoke such that the front surface of the faceplate remains flush with a front surface of the electrical device insert.
